Gameplay
Instant
Strive — This spell costs {1}{W} more to cast for each target beyond the first. Choose any number of target opponents. Create X 1/1 white Human Soldier creature tokens, where X is the number of creatures those opponents control.
When the alarm crystals flash, Drannith's finest answer the call.

Card type: Instant. Color identity: white. Mana cost: {2}{W} (3 converted). Keyword abilities: Strive.

Legal in Legacy, Vintage, and Commander.

EDHrec ranks this card concept #1,515 in Commander, putting it in the common-include tier of the format's playable pool.
